Croatia received a significant boost to its World Cup qualification hopes thanks to favorable outcomes in other groups, particularly results involving Mexico and Brazil.

Mexico's decisive 3-0 victory over Czechia on Tuesday significantly aided Croatia's prospects. This win left the Czech Republic with only a single point, effectively pushing them down the rankings of potential third-placed teams vying for a spot in the knockout stage. Croatia is competing to be among the eight best third-placed teams that advance to the round of 16.

Further positive news arrived from the match between Brazil and Scotland. Brazil, already having secured their group's top spot, defeated Scotland 3-0. The goals, scored by Vinรญcius Jรบnior and Cunha, not only secured Brazil's dominant performance but also negatively impacted Scotland's goal difference, leaving them with a 1:4 record and a -3 differential. This result is also beneficial for Croatia's chances of progressing.

While Bosnia and Herzegovina's 3-1 victory over Qatar was initially seen as potentially helpful, the results from the Mexico-Czechia and Brazil-Scotland matches provided more direct advantages. These outcomes collectively improve Croatia's standing as they await further results that could determine their path to the next round of the tournament.
